Output 3697bca2c976d171e7dffbde7028317f66e51bf698c2300a735a3d2d8e78baaf:1

value
19760109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d342b848de9890da11c1a7b229e591658181b257 OP_EQUAL
address
3Lx4RoCCH57zLec1twmsiJZuu15A8HwKRY
transaction
3697bca2c976d171e7dffbde7028317f66e51bf698c2300a735a3d2d8e78baaf
confirmations
117384
spent
true